Sports Safety Summit Attracting National Attention as Concussion TV Features Live Webcast of Major Athletic Trainers Event

Athletic Trainers, Physicians, Experts, Congressman Bill Pascrell and others to be Featured in National Webcast of Athletic Trainers' Society of New Jersey's 3rd Annual Sports Safety Summit for Parents, Coaches and Athletes, Live from New Brunswick, N.J. August 1, 2012, 7:40 AM ET at Internet TV Channel Concussion TV, www.ConcussionTV.com


Washington, D.C., July 31, 2012 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- TV Worldwide, (www.tvworldwide.com), a pioneering web-based global TV network since 1999, announced that it had been selected by Sports Pro Community Network (SPCN, www.SPCN.com) to webcast the Athletic Trainers' Society of New Jersey's 3rd Annual Sports Safety Summit, the second in a series of free live national TV webcasts featuring distinguished experts in the field of Concussion and Traumatic Brain Injury (TBI), Wednesday, August 1, 2012, 7:40 AM ET, live from New Brunswick, N.J.

The event is being produced on SPCN's recently-launched Internet TV channel, Concussion TV, (www.ConcussionTV.com) and will also highlight other sports safety issues and presentations. The live webcast is sponsored by the National Athletic Trainers' Association, District 2, Concussion Health, Natus, Impakt Protective's Shockbox impact alert sensors, and the Sports Concussion Center of New Jersey at the RSM Psychology Center, LLC.

The webcast will feature prominent experts, experienced in the field of sports safety science with practical applications for physicians and health care providers. The webcast will also highlight pre-recorded interviews with Congressman Bill Pascrell of New Jersey, Robin Harris, Executive Director of the Council of Ivy league Presidents, andformer NFL quarterback Ron "Jaws" Jaworski with Dr. Rosemarie Scolaro Moser, Director of the Sports Concussion Center of New Jersey, discussing concussion in football and her new book "Ahead of the Game".

About the Athletic Trainers' Society of New Jersey (ATSNJ)

The Athletic Trainers' Society (ATSNJ) consists of Certified Athletic Trainers, Athletic Training Students, Physicians and other allied health care professionals living or employed in the State of New Jersey. Working together, our goal is to the advancement and improvement of the athletic training profession in the State. The ATSNJ also continually strives to ensure that athletes receive the best health care possible.

The Athletic Trainers' Society of New Jersey is:

  • ATSNJ, Inc.
  • Composed primarily of members certified by the National Athletic Trainers Association Board of Cerfication &/or Licensed by the New Jersey Board of Medical Examiners.
  • Dedicated to the advancement, and improvement of the Athletic Training profession in the state of New Jersey.
  • Continually striving to ensure that the student-athlete receives the best possible health care.

The Goals of the ATSNJ:

  • Educate the general public as to the role and function of an Athletic Trainer.
  • Provide sports care information to related health care organizations and other groups.
  • Encourage students to enter the Athletic Training profession by offering information and scholarships.
  • Provide speakers bureau.
  • Educate athletes of their right to proper health care.
